- Please note - UK Posting!!
-
- Last year, I bought an Intel SatisFAXtion/200 for my
- Royale 486/33. I couldn't get it to work at all, and was
- referred by the supplier to Intel Tech. Support. They
- were very good, told me that the /200 `didn't work in
- the UK' (no reason given), and offered me a replacement
- of the original SatisFAXtion board. This didn't work
- either, and I discovered that my problem was the lead
- to the phone socket. So I tried the /200 again, as it is a
- far superior piece of kit with MNP5 and V.42 (and only
- half length), and it worked sending both by fax and modem,
- but when someone tried to send to me by either means, the
- phone line went funny (faint ringing sound on the line) and
- didn't recover until I switched the PC off completely.
-
- I really want to use the /200 as it has error-correction and
- compression, so can anyone help me and tell me why it
- doesn't let me receive anything.
-
- BTW, I am still on an analogue exchange; is this the problem?
